Transaction 5836c0e39b9bca80d6b59f592083b5e8393f748862e072683ca17e68ae6fb550
1 Input
1 Output
-
5836c0e39b9bca80d6b59f592083b5e8393f748862e072683ca17e68ae6fb550:0
- value
- 3103060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 006d93b928831bae6fe37d40f7b7ca10ebb08021 OP_EQUAL
- address
- 31jHC6BrAQKG84yYbmyuDFJXbyG1qXC22q